![]() Earn European credits at the 2019 SEID The Scientific and Educational Interaction Day (SEID) has been accredited by the European Accreditation Council for Continuing Medical Education (EACCME®) with 10 European CME credits (ECMEC®s). Each medical specialist should only claim the hours of credit that he/she actually spent doing the educational activity. Through an agreement between the Union Européenne des Médecins Spécialistes and the American Medical Association, physicians may convert EACCME® credits to an equivalent number of AMA PRA Category 1 CreditsTM. Information on the process on how to convert EACCME® credits into AMA credits can be found at www.ama-assn.org/education/earn-credit-participation-international-activities. ![]() Just published online: read the latest CKJ article
Two decades of the Eurotransplant Senior Program: the gender gap in mortality impacts patient survival after kidney transplantation Long-term outcomes of the Eurotransplant Senior Program (ESP) are urgently needed to improve selection criteria and allocation policies in the elderly. Long-term outcomes of ESP-KTRs ultimately support the effectiveness of an age-matched allocation system. Authors, supported by data, suggest that the survival advantage of women is maintained after kidney transplantation and calls for gender-specific care. Click here to read the paper.
